Development of an electrotransformation protocol for genetic manipulation of Clostridium pasteurianum
Abstract
BackgroundReducing the production cost of, and increasing revenues from, industrial biofuels will greatly facilitate their proliferation and co-integration with fossil fuels. The cost of feedstock is the largest cost in most fermentation bioprocesses and therefore represents an important target for cost reduction.
